“Sub-prime king” John Paulson – The Rise and Fall of a Legend

“Sub-prime king” John Paulson – The Rise and Fall of a Legend

4 mins. to read

John Paulson is probably one of the most well-known hedge fund managers in the world due to his infamous call on shorting US Sub-prime mortgages through a complex instrument called CDO’s (basically out of the money put options on the value of these bonds). He racked up a stellar performance in2007 and 2008 as the…
